presto-8.x-2.2/themes/presto_theme/templates/commerce/input.html.twig
themes/presto_theme/templates/commerce/input.html.twig
{#
/**
* @file
* Default theme implementation for an 'input' #type form element.
*
* Available variables:
* - attributes: A list of HTML attributes for the input element.
* - children: Optional additional rendered elements.
* - icon: An icon.
* - input_group: Flag to display as an input group.
* - icon_position: Where an icon should be displayed.
* - prefix: Markup to display before the input element.
* - suffix: Markup to display after the input element.
* - type: The type of input.
*
* @ingroup templates
*
* @see \Drupal\bootstrap\Plugin\Preprocess\Input
* @see template_preprocess_input()
*/
#}
{% spaceless %}
{% if prefix %}
{{ prefix }}
{% endif %}
{% block input %}
<input{{ attributes.addClass('form-text') }} />
{% endblock %}
{% if suffix %}
{{ suffix }}
{% endif %}
{{ children }}
{% endspaceless %}
